Logitech posted this review by Newegg's GameCrate. I was a bit confused by the fact that newegg now has their own separate review thing. I guess their getting into ever corner of the market now.

The most interesting thing I found was actually in the comments.

Pawz2142: Is the DPI adjustable in 50,100, or 200 increments?

Guest: 50 until ~1800, then it goes in 100s.

I think this confirms my idea that after a certain point that there are just multiplying the base resolution. This is good thing but i really wish they would restrict it to or at least tell you which ones are a exact multiple of the sensors resolution. The last thing that made me think was that he said the 50 increments stop at 1800. The Razers software recommends 1600-1800 for the DA 2013. Its sensor the max it goes to is ~6400 which is roughly half of the G502. the Da 2013 is also infrared, which is what logitech's "Delta Zero Sensor" stands for. From that I think that there is a good chance that the two mice share the same sensor.

Mice with the ergonomics of the G700/G700s take quite a bit of time between iterations compare to some of their other models. The main reason is is unlike the MX500/MX518/G400/G400s they change the mouse significantly every time but keeping the same ergonomics some how. That family looks something like this MX Revolution, MX 1100, Performance MX, G700, and G700s. I have a feeling that the G702 has actually been cooking for some time as the G700 is actually a older mouse that didnt even have the LGS originally and the G700s is just a slight change/improvement.
